The Dewalt DW862 is a portable saw designed to handle a variety of cuts in natural stones, tile ceramics and other man-made materials. Ideal for tile installers, pavers, remodelers, electrical contractors, masonry and concrete professionals, the DW862 has the versatility contractors demand with its ability to make cross-cuts, beveled or angle cuts and miter cuts in addition to plunge and other compound cuts. At just over six pounds, the DW862 Tile Cutter features an 1,300 watts motor that delivers 13,000 RPMs, giving professionals the power and speed they need in a lightweight package. a steel shoe and 45-degree bevel capacity for precise cuts. The 110mm (4") blade that comes with the tool features an aggressive diamond matrix design for cutting porcelain and granite. The 35mm (1-3/8") depth of cut allows contractors to cut up to 1-1/4" thick counter tops. A lock-on button is conveniently located near the trigger, which allows end users to hold the trigger on for ease of use during extended cuts. For durability, dust seals have been incorporated into the handle and trigger to reduce the chances of dust and debris damaging the tool. The DW862 is well balanced and lightweight. Its handle has an ergonomic design and it has been enhanced with rubber overmold for user comfort even after extended use.
